    John Deere 1020 engine problem

    Hey guy's, got a generic diesel engine question for yall. 3 cyl. John Deere 1020 engine refuses to run longer than a few seconds. Starts up great and slowly dies out. It sounds to me like it's running out of fuel pressure to where the injectors quit firing. The IP was rebuilt under 50 hours ago...
